In the next episode of the series "America of the Seventies," political commentator Valentin Zorin talks about the capital of the United States of America - Washington. There are bigger and more beautiful rivers in America, if not the Potomac River meandering among the plains of the Atlantic coast of the country, but for many reasons: geographical, economic and political order, at the end of the 18th century, it is here, at the junction of the industrial north and the plantation south, not far from places where the waters of the Potomac disappear without a trace in the vast bulk of the Atlantic, a city named after George Washington was founded.
